PART 3Amendments to Schedule 1 to the 2013 Regulations

Amendment to paragraph 1236

In paragraph 12 (extension of time limits)—

a

omit sub-paragraph (1);

b

for sub-paragraph (2) substitute—

2

Subject to sub-paragraph (2B), if a person submits an application for a marketing authorisation or for a variation to a marketing authorisation for a product, and within five years of the original marketing authorisation being granted, the marketing authorisation is extended to include an additional major species or a new antimicrobial product, the relevant protection period is extended by one year for each additional major species added to the marketing authorisation.

2A

Subject to sub-paragraph (2B), if a person submits an application for a marketing authorisation mentioned in sub-paragraph (2) and the marketing authorisation is extended to include an additional minor species, the relevant protection period is extended by four years.

2B

Sub-paragraphs (2) and (2A) do not apply where the application to extend the marketing authorisation is made fewer than three years before the expiration of the protection period.

c

in sub-paragraph (3) for “13” substitute “18”;

d

omit sub-paragraph (4).
